Looking for Italian dinner ideas? Here are MORE than 50 classic Italian dinner recipes you can cook tonight. Discover everything from quick weeknight pastas to traditional Sunday feasts. Start with 10 quick dinners under 30 minutes, or explore complete menus from antipasto to dolce.
Planning an Italian meal in the summer? Check out all my favorite summer Italian recipes!
10 Quick Italian Dinner Ideas (Under 30 Minutes)
For those nights when you simply don’t have time to spend hours in the kitchen but want a hearty Italian dinner that will fill bellies and leave happy faces, turn to these classic dishes. They are guaranteed crowd pleasers and no one will know they took less than 30 minutes to prepare.
Ciao, I’m Elena! I was born and raised in Sardinia, where dinner is never just food — it’s the heart of family life. Every meal is a chance to gather, share stories, and celebrate simple, seasonal ingredients.
The Italian recipes you’ll find here are the same ones I grew up with and still cook for my family today, from quick weeknight pasta, like this authentic carbonara recipe, to the long, slow Sunday dinners I learned from my nonna, like her famous sugo al pomodoro.
With my background in Italian cooking and a deep love for preserving tradition, I’ll help you bring the warmth and authenticity of an Italian table right into your home.
These traditional Italian appetizers are a perfect way to start a hearty meal that will please your whole family and have them begging for seconds! Enjoy them as a starter for a meal, called antipasti in Italian, or enjoy them as a party appetizer. You will find everything from simple classics like bruschetta to more adventurous flavors, like this nduja ricotta toast.
5 from 1 vote
Baked Stuffed Clams
Classic Italian stuffed clams, baked with crispy breadcrumbs, parsley, oregano, and garlic for a simple yet elegant seafood appetizer.
You will love these irresistible crispy bites that melt in your mouth. There are only 3 simple ingredients in these cheesy and crispy bites, and they take only 20 minutes to make!
Toasted bread rubbed with garlic and topped with ripe tomatoes, creamy mozzarella, and fresh basil — a classic Italian appetizer that’s light, flavorful, and perfect for sharing.
Meaty portobello mushrooms roasted with balsamic vinegar, garlic, and thyme make an earthy, flavorful, and healthy Italian appetizer you’ll want to make again and again.
Creamy cannellini beans blended with roasted garlic, fresh rosemary, and blistered tomatoes for a rich, savory dip. This easy Italian appetizer is perfect for gatherings or as a cozy snack with warm crusty bread or fresh vegetables.
Italians love their contorni — simple vegetable sides that balance the meal and highlight seasonal ingredients. These Italian side dishes, from roasted zucchini to peas with pancetta, add color and flavor to any dinner table.
5 from 4 votes
Italian Grilled Eggplant
Tender slices of eggplant grilled and dressed with garlic, parsley, fresh basil, and extra-virgin olive oil are smoky, aromatic, and effortlessly simple. A classic Italian side dish that pairs beautifully with grilled meats or pasta.
Sweet carrots roasted in the oven with a light honey glaze until tender and caramelized. It's simple, colorful, and delicious. Serve as an easy Italian-inspired side dish, with an optional sprinkle of feta or toasted pine nuts for extra flavor.
Crisp green beans roasted with shallots, garlic, lemon juice, and zest in olive oil are bright, flavorful, and perfectly tender. A fresh and easy Italian side dish that pairs well with chicken, fish, or pasta.
A lighter, easier take on classic eggplant Parmesan with layers of tender eggplant, marinara sauce, and creamy ricotta. All the comforting Italian flavors you love, in a simple and elegant presentation.
Sweet green peas sautéed with savory pancetta and a touch of onion. It's a quick, flavorful, and classic Italian side dish that brings comfort to any meal.
Crisp roasted Brussels sprouts tossed with olive oil, garlic, and plenty of Parmesan cook up golden, nutty, and so flavorful. A simple Italian-inspired side dish that’s perfect for weeknights or holiday dinners.
An easy and comforting accompaniment for any Italian dinner party! Many of these Italian soup recipes can also stand alone as a main dish — just add a side of my easy ciabatta bread with Italian bread dipping oil for the perfect pairing. Whether it’s a classic like pasta e fagioli or a cozy bowl of Tuscan ribollita, these soups are the ultimate way to start or even complete your Italian meal.
5 from 42 votes
Traditional Pasta e Fagioli
Small pasta, beans, pancetta, and vegetables simmered in a savory broth — hearty, comforting, and full of rustic Italian flavor. Enjoy as a cozy main dish with crusty bread or serve as a warming first course in a traditional Italian dinner.
A classic Italian vegetable soup made with seasonal vegetables, beans, and pasta. It's light yet hearty and rooted in la cucina povera traditions. Serve as a wholesome main dish with bread or as a nourishing first course.
A creamy Tuscan soup made with potatoes, bacon, onion, garlic, and kale — rich, comforting, and full of flavor. Indulgent yet balanced with bright, nutritious greens, it makes an easy and satisfying main dish or a cozy first course.
A velvety broth-based soup made without cream, featuring tender artichokes and fresh herbs for earthy balance and delicate texture. It’s an elegant Italian soup to serve as a light main course or a refined first course any time of year.
A nourishing Italian classic made with tender meatballs, fresh vegetables, and acini de pepe pasta in a savory broth — hearty, comforting, and full of flavor. Easy to prep ahead and perfect as a cozy main dish or a warming first course, even in the slow cooker.
Called secondi in Italy, these hearty main courses are the centerpiece of any Italian dinner. From slow-braised classics like beef short rib ragu to elegant dishes such as pistachio crusted rack of lamb, these recipes are full of flavor and tradition. For something easy and foolproof, don’t miss my baked chicken thighs! Explore these authentic Italian meat dishes and find the perfect centerpiece for your next dinner.
5 from 8 votes
Italian Beef Braciole Recipe
Thinly sliced steak rolled with Italian herbs, cheese, prosciutto, and breadcrumbs, then slow-cooked in red wine and rich tomato sauce. A cozy, comforting Italian main dish perfect for Sunday dinner or special family gatherings
Juicy chicken breasts stuffed with fresh mozzarella and basil, wrapped in savory prosciutto di Parma, and finished with a rich pan sauce from the drippings. An elegant Italian main dish that’s simple enough for weeknights yet special enough for entertaining.
A classic Italian dish of sausage and bell peppers simmered together in one pan for a meal that's hearty, flavorful, and incredibly easy. A family favorite main course that comes together quickly for weeknight dinners or casual gatherings.
Thin chicken cutlets breaded and pan-fried until golden and crunchy on the outside, tender and juicy inside. A versatile Italian main dish that’s delicious on its own, served with pasta, or layered into a classic chicken Parmesan
Juicy pork tenderloin served with sautéed shallots and fennel for a delicate, slightly sweet flavor combination. A refined yet easy Italian main dish that’s perfect for family dinners or special occasions.
A tender rack of lamb seared, oven-roasted, and topped with a golden pistachio and mustard crust. This dish is flavorful, elegant, and perfect as a show-stopping Italian main dish for holidays or special gatherings.
Braised veal shanks slowly cooked with onions, carrots, celery, white wine, and broth until fork-tender and rich in flavor. A classic Northern Italian main dish, traditionally served with risotto alla Milanese or creamy polenta.
Juicy, tender meatballs made with a blend of beef and pork, breadcrumbs, Parmesan, and fresh herbs, simmered in a rich tomato sauce. A beloved Italian main dish that’s perfect over pasta, with crusty bread, or as part of a Sunday family dinner.
Pan-seared salmon topped with a bright lemon and caper piccata-style sauce. It's light, zesty, and full of flavor. A simple yet elegant Italian seafood main dish that’s perfect for weeknights or entertaining.
Tender flounder fillets filled with a savory blend of lump crab, shrimp, breadcrumbs, and fresh herbs. A special Italian-inspired seafood main dish perfect for holidays or dinner parties.
Juicy, tender sea bass seared to perfection and finished with a silky lemon butter sauce. It's rich, delicate, and melt-in-your-mouth delicious. An elegant Italian seafood main dish ideal for special occasions or a romantic dinner.
Light and tender flounder fillets baked with olive oil, garlic, lemon, and fresh herbs A fish dish that's simple, healthy, and full of delicate flavor. A quick Italian seafood main dish that’s perfect for weeknights.
Flaky cod fillets baked with tomatoes, olives, garlic, and fresh herbs. It's light, savory, and bursting with Mediterranean flavor. A wholesome Italian seafood main dish that’s easy enough for weeknights yet impressive for guests.
Classic Italian spaghetti tossed with tender clams in a garlicky white wine and olive oil sauce. A traditional pasta dish that’s elegant enough for entertaining yet simple for a weeknight dinner.
Authentic Roman carbonara made with just four ingredients — pasta, eggs, guanciale, and Pecorino Romano. Creamy without cream, rich, and irresistibly savory, this Italian classic is a quick pasta dish that feels indulgent yet simple.
A traditional Sardinian pasta made with malloreddus — small gnocchi-like shells — simmered in a rich tomato sauce with Italian sausage and a touch of saffron. A comforting regional specialty and hearty main dish from the heart of Sardinia.
A classic Roman pasta from Lazio made with guanciale, Pecorino Romano, and black pepper. Simple yet deeply flavorful, this authentic dish is proof that the best Italian recipes need only a handful of ingredients.
Delicate orzo pasta tossed with roasted seasonal vegetables, a light lemon dressing, fresh basil, and shavings of Parmigiano. Bright, colorful, and refreshing, it's a versatile Italian dish that works as a main course or a flavorful side.
A cheesy baked lasagna layered with roasted Mediterranean vegetables, savory tomato sauce, and a blend of four cheeses. Golden, hearty, and full of flavor. A delicious twist on the classic Italian comfort dish.
Luxurious pasta tossed in a rich black truffle sauce with butter and Parmigiano — earthy, aromatic, and indulgent. A gourmet Italian dish that’s simple to prepare yet perfect for a special dinner. Ready in 20 minutes!
Italian salads are fresh, vibrant, and always tied to the seasons. From the rustic Tuscan panzanella to crisp green salads, these recipes add brightness and balance to any Italian dinner menu. Pair them with everything from a tender steak cooked on the grill or a hearty pasta bake.
5 from 4 votes
Panzanella Salad Recipe
A traditional Tuscan bread salad made with toasted bread, ripe tomatoes, fresh basil, olive oil, and a splash of vinegar. Refreshing, rustic, and full of flavor. It's the perfect Italian side dish for summer meals.
Peppery arugula tossed with crisp apples, toasted pistachios, and a bright lemon dressing. Light, crunchy, and refreshing — enjoy on its own or elevate it by serving in elegant Parmesan cups.
Sweet ripe pears paired with tangy gorgonzola and finished with an orange honey mustard vinaigrette. Each bite is the perfect balance of sweet, sharp, and savory. An elegant Italian-inspired salad ideal for fall dinners or holiday gatherings.
Crisp fennel, juicy orange, and ruby pomegranate seeds tossed with toasted hazelnuts are vibrant, refreshing, and full of texture. A colorful Italian winter salad that brightens any dinner table.
Sweet, tender king crab mixed with crisp vegetables and a light lemon dressing. An elegant Italian-inspired salad that's fresh, delicate, and full of flavor. It works beautifully as a starter or light main course.
Chopped vegetables, olives, Italian meats, and cheeses tossed in a zesty Italian dressing — hearty, colorful, and packed with flavor. A versatile salad that works as a refreshing side or a satisfying main dish.
Finish your Italian dinner with something sweet! From creamy tiramisu to festive Sicilian cannoli, and seasonal fruit desserts, these Italian desserts or dolci are the perfect way to end your meal on a delicious note.
5 from 5 votes
Panna Cotta Recipe
Classic Italian dessert that is creamy, silky, and luxurious. I like to serve mine with an easy berry sauce, but there are so many delicious toppings to switch it up.
A light and refreshing twist on the Italian classic, made with fresh strawberries, mascarpone, whipped cream, orange zest, and soft ladyfingers. A beautiful no-bake dessert that’s perfect for spring and summer gatherings.
Crisp, golden pastry shells filled with sweet ricotta cream and dipped in chocolate chips, pistachios, or candied fruit. A festive and iconic Italian dessert that’s as fun to decorate as it is to eat.
A traditional Italian dessert with a creamy ricotta filling flavored with lemon zest, almond, and vanilla, baked inside a delicate pie shell. Often enjoyed at Easter, this sweet pie is light, elegant, and timeless.
Delicate pastry cups filled with ricotta, lemon zest, orange peel, and a hint of saffron. A traditional Sardinian dessert often finished with powdered sugar or colorful sprinkles, perfect for Easter and festive occasions.
Buttery cake crumbles layered around a smooth, velvety pastry cream filling that's rich, tender, and irresistible. A classic Italian dessert that’s as beautiful as it is delicious, perfect for special occasions or Sunday gatherings.
Thick, rich, and indulgent! This Italian-style hot chocolate is creamy enough to eat with a spoon. A cozy winter treat that warms the soul, just like it’s served in cafés across Italy.
What are the most popular Italian dinner recipes in Italy?
In Italy, the most loved Italian dinner ideas vary by region, but some classics are found on tables everywhere. Pasta dishes lasagna bolognese is always popular, as well as hearty meat dishes such as osso buco. Of course, pizza is an Italian favorite — from a simple Margherita to regional specialties, like a Neapolitan pizza or pinsa Romana. And for dessert, classic tiramisu and gelato are beloved across the country.
How do Italians structure dinner using multiple courses?
Traditional Italian dinners follow a course structure:
• Aperitivo: A light drink or small bite to stimulate the appetite, such as olives, nuts, or a spritz. • Antipasti: Starters like bruschetta, cured meats, or cheese boards. • Primi: The first course, often pasta, risotto, or soup. • Secondi: The main dish, typically meat or fish. • Contorni: Vegetable side dishes that accompany the secondi. • Insalata: A simple green salad, usually served after the main course to cleanse the palate. • Dolce: Dessert, such as panna cotta, tiramisù, or fresh fruit.
This full structure is most common on Sundays, holidays, or dining out at restaurants, while everyday family dinners are usually simplified to just one or two courses.
What are some vegetarian Italian dinner ideas?
Italy is full of naturally vegetarian recipes! Try eggplant Parmesan or pasta e ceci for hearty mains. Soups and salads are often easy to make vegetarian like my Tuscan white bean soup. For a complete vegetarian Italian dinner, serve a pasta as the main, add a couple of contorni, and finish with a fruit-based dolce.
No matter the occasion, this collection of Classic Italian Dinner Ideas has you covered — from quick weeknight meals to full Sunday feasts. These 50+ authentic Italian recipes bring the flavors of Italy straight to your table, just as my family has enjoyed them for generations. I hope they inspire you to cook, gather, and share the joy of Italian food with the people you love. Buon appetito!
💙 MADE any of these RECIPES AND LOVED IT? 💙 Please leave a ⭐️STAR rating and COMMENT in the post or a comment below telling me about your favorite. I love connecting with you! Tag me with your creations on Instagram and find me on Pinterest.
My dream is to share delicious wholesome recipes that you will share around the table with all your loved ones. The memories surrounded by food are the heart and soul of CucinaByElena.
Fabulous recipes. Authentic.
Thank you! So happy you love!